Institute of Technology is a private institution in Clovis, California with 1,376 undergraduate students. For nursing students, the useful read is not just whether a program exists, but how its tuition, completion rates, debt, and earnings compare with nearby options.
In-state tuition is N/A compared with a California nursing-school average of $10,571. The school reports a graduation rate of 74.5%, median earnings of $35,095, and median federal debt of $9,500.
N/A is compared with the state average of $10,571.
74.5% is higher than the state average of 55.0%.
$35,095 is lower than the state average of $43,430.

Affordability Context
29.2% of students receive Pell Grants, a useful signal for how often the school serves lower-income students. 32.7% of students take federal loans, so borrowing is less common than at many institutions in the student body. The three-year loan default rate is 0.0%, which helps frame repayment risk alongside earnings and debt.

Student Demographics
The student body is largest among Hispanic students (47.4%), followed by White students (31.3%) and Asian students (7.9%).
